商业分析学什么编程
-
商业分析需要掌握的编程技能有以下几个方面:
-
SQL编程:商业分析师需要能够使用SQL语言来查询和操作数据库。SQL是一种结构化查询语言,常用于从数据库中提取数据、筛选数据、聚合数据等操作。商业分析师需要学会使用SQL来处理大量的数据,进行数据的清洗、转换和分析。
-
Python编程:Python是一种通用的编程语言,在商业分析领域也得到广泛应用。商业分析师可以使用Python来进行数据清洗、数据处理、数据可视化等工作。此外,商业分析师还可以使用Python来构建数据模型、机器学习模型等,以支持业务决策。
-
R编程:R是一种统计分析和数据可视化的编程语言,对于商业分析师来说也是一种必备的技能。商业分析师可以使用R来进行数据探索、数据分析、统计建模等工作。R提供了丰富的数据分析包和可视化工具,可以帮助商业分析师更好地理解和解释数据。
-
Excel VBA编程:Excel是商业分析师常用的数据分析工具之一,而VBA(Visual Basic for Applications)是一种用于在Excel中编写宏的编程语言。商业分析师可以使用VBA来自动化任务、创建自定义函数、实现交互式报告等。
-
数据库管理系统(DBMS):商业分析师需要熟悉一些常见的数据库管理系统,如Oracle、MySQL、SQL Server等。对于大规模数据的处理和管理,商业分析师需要了解数据库的设计原理、索引优化、性能调优等。
总结起来,商业分析师需要掌握SQL、Python、R等编程语言,以及Excel VBA和数据库管理系统等技能,这样可以更好地处理和分析大量的数据,并为业务决策提供准确的支持。
1年前 -
-
商业分析师在日常工作中可能需要掌握一些编程技能来提高工作效率和解决问题。以下是商业分析师常用的几种编程语言和技术:
-
SQL:结构化查询语言(SQL)是一个用于管理和操作关系型数据库的标准语言。商业分析师经常需要在数据库中查询和提取数据,以便进行数据分析和生成报告。熟练掌握SQL可以帮助商业分析师更好地使用和管理大量数据。
-
Python:Python是一种通用的编程语言,因其简洁易读和强大的数据处理能力而受到广泛应用。商业分析师可以使用Python进行数据清洗、数据分析和可视化。Python也有丰富的数据处理库和工具,如pandas、numpy和matplotlib,可以帮助商业分析师更快地处理数据。
-
R:R是一种专门用于统计分析和数据可视化的编程语言。商业分析师可以使用R来执行各种统计分析和建模任务。R具有丰富的统计和数据处理包,如ggplot2和dplyr,可以帮助商业分析师更好地理解和展示数据。
-
Excel VBA:Excel VBA是一种宏语言,可以在Excel中编写脚本来自动化重复的任务和执行复杂的数据分析。商业分析师可以使用Excel VBA来开发自定义的函数和宏,以提高数据处理和报告生成的效率。
-
HTML/CSS/JavaScript:商业分析师可能需要在数据分析报告中创建交互式可视化图表和仪表板。为了实现这一点,了解基本的前端技术如HTML、CSS和JavaScript将很有帮助。这些技术可以帮助商业分析师创建动态和可交互的数据可视化。
商业分析师可以根据自己的工作需求选择适合自己的编程语言和技术。掌握一些编程技能可以让商业分析师更好地处理和分析数据,提高工作效率,为企业决策提供更有价值的洞察。
1年前 -
-
商业分析是指通过数据分析和统计模型来评估和预测商业环境中的机会和挑战,以支持企业的决策和战略制定。在现代商业环境中,数据和信息成为了最重要的资产之一,因此掌握编程技巧对于商业分析师来说至关重要。
商业分析师可以通过学习多种编程语言和工具来提升其分析能力和效率。下面是一些常用的编程语言和工具,适用于不同的商业分析任务。
-
Excel和VBA编程:
Excel是商业分析工作中最常用的软件之一,商业分析师通常需要使用Excel来处理和分析数据。VBA(Visual Basic for Applications)是一种用于自动化Excel的编程语言,商业分析师可以通过学习VBA编程,编写宏来自动化重复的任务,提高工作效率。 -
SQL编程:
SQL(Structured Query Language)是用于管理和查询关系型数据库的标准语言。商业分析师可以使用SQL来提取和分析数据库中的数据,进行数据清洗、聚合、筛选等操作。掌握SQL编程可以帮助商业分析师更好地理解和利用数据。 -
Python编程:
Python是一种简洁、易读的高级编程语言,广泛应用于数据分析和机器学习领域。商业分析师可以使用Python进行数据处理、建模和可视化等任务。Python具有丰富的数据分析库(如numpy、pandas和matplotlib),使得商业分析师能够更灵活地处理和分析数据。 -
R编程:
R是一种专门用于统计分析和数据可视化的编程语言。商业分析师可以使用R来进行统计分析、绘制图表等。R具有丰富的数据分析包(如tidyverse和ggplot2),能够帮助商业分析师进行深入的数据探索和建模。 -
Tableau和Power BI:
Tableau和Power BI是两种常用的商业智能工具,商业分析师可以使用它们来创建交互式的数据可视化报表。这些工具提供了易于使用的界面,商业分析师可以通过拖拽和配置,快速生成图表和仪表板。
除了以上列举的编程语言和工具,商业分析师还可以根据具体的需求学习其他编程语言和技术,如Java、C++、JavaScript、Hadoop等。关键在于了解数据分析和商业分析领域的具体要求,并选择适合自己的编程语言和工具。通过学习和应用编程技能,商业分析师可以更好地发现商业机会和挑战,支持企业的决策和发展。
1年前 -